Hi,

I own a acer 5684 notebook with a nvidia geforce 7600 card in it, vista as operating system.

About a month ago it died on me while i was working with it.

No way to power-up again so i contacted acer support and my notebook was send to the repair center.

When it came back i f***** up my windows so i tried doing a clean install of the operating system.

No way to install because it always crashed on the video drivers or ^powers up and shows pink dots

Because i knew XP pro was more stable and i own it from my previous pc i installed it thinking i had a Vista problem.

Installation goes fine, all my programs work, but when i try to install any other video driver than the standard vga driver my screen goes pink dots again and crashes.

Pink dots or any kind of graphical artifact is usually a sign of video card failure. I would have Acer take it back again for repairs.
